Danube FloodRisk Project
The overall objective of the Danube FLOODRISK project was to develop and produce high quality, stakeholder oriented flood hazard and flood risk maps for the transnational Danube river floodplains to provide adequate risk information for spatial planning and economic development activities.
Hydropower
Following a request by the Danube Ministerial Conference 2010, the ICPDR has become active in initiating a dialogue with representatives from the hydropower sector. As an essential step in this process, "Guiding Principles on Sustainable Hydropower Development in the Danube Basin" have been developed by an interdisciplinary team and were finalised and adopted in June 2013.
Joint Danube Survey
The key purpose of Joint Danube Surveys (JDS) is to produce reliable and comparable information on carefully selected elements of water quality for the length of the Danube River, including its major tributaries. Three Joint Danube Surveys have previously been conducted, in 2001, 2007, 2013, and 2019. The 5th Joint Danube Survey is due to launch on 1st July 2025.
European Riverprize
The IRF European Riverprize is awarded annually since 2013 to reward best practice river basin management from the Urals to the Atlantic. The award was launched in a partnership between the ICPDR, the Coca-Cola Compay, the International River Foundation (IRF) and the European Center for River Restoration.

Climate Change Adaptation
Climate change poses a serious threat to our ability to manage our water resources in the Danube River Basin. In response, the ICPDR updated its Strategy on Adaptation to Climate Change in 2018 based on the most recent research in the field.

Groundwater
Groundwater constitutes the largest reservoir of freshwater in the world, accounting for over 97% of all freshwaters available on earth (excluding glaciers and ice caps). The remaining 3% is composed mainly of surface water (lakes, rivers, wetlands) and soil moisture. By incorporation into the Water Framework Directive (WFD), groundwater became part of an integrated water management system.
